亚洲 国产精品 日韩-亚洲 激情-亚洲 欧美 91-亚洲 欧美 成人日韩-青青青草视频在线观看-青青青草影院

千鋒教育-做有情懷、有良心、有品質的職業教育機構

手機站
千鋒教育

千鋒學習站 | 隨時隨地免費學

千鋒教育

掃一掃進入千鋒手機站

領取全套視頻
千鋒教育

關注千鋒學習站小程序
隨時隨地免費學習課程

當前位置:首頁  >  千鋒問問  > java相對路徑讀取文件怎么操作

java相對路徑讀取文件怎么操作

java相對路徑 匿名提問者 2023-09-13 14:04:13

java相對路徑讀取文件怎么操作

我要提問

推薦答案

  Java中,可以使用相對路徑來讀取文件。相對路徑是相對于當前工作目錄或者指定的基準目錄進行解析的路徑。下面是使用相對路徑讀取文件的一般操作步驟:

千鋒教育

  獲取當前工作目錄:可以使用System.getProperty("user.dir")方法獲取當前Java程序所在的工作目錄??梢酝ㄟ^這個方法獲取當前工作目錄的絕對路徑。

  構建文件路徑:使用相對路徑構建文件的完整路徑。相對路徑可以是與當前工作目錄相關的路徑,也可以是與指定的基準目錄相關的路徑。

  創建File對象:使用構建好的路徑創建一個File對象,這個對象代表了要讀取的文件。

  檢查文件是否存在:可以使用File對象的exists()方法來檢查文件是否存在。如果文件不存在,可以根據需要處理相應的邏輯。

  讀取文件內容:如果文件存在,可以使用Java的文件讀取方式,如FileInputStream、BufferedReader等進行文件內容的讀取。

  下面是一個示例代碼,演示了如何使用相對路徑讀取文件:

  javaimport java.io.BufferedReader;

  import java.io.File;

  import java.io.FileReader;

  import java.io.IOException;

  public class RelativePathExample {

  public static void main(String[] args) {

  // 獲取當前工作目錄

  String currentDir = System.getProperty("user.dir");

  // 構建文件路徑

  String relativePath = "data/file.txt";

  String filePath = currentDir + File.separator + relativePath;

  // 創建File對象

  File file = new File(filePath);

  // 檢查文件是否存在

  if (file.exists()) {

  try {

  // 讀取文件內容

  BufferedReader reader = new BufferedReader(new FileReader(file));

  String line;

  while ((line = reader.readLine()) != null) {

  System.out.println(line);

  }

  reader.close();

  } catch (IOException e) {

  e.printStackTrace();

  }

  } else {

  System.out.println("文件不存在");

  }

  }

  }

  在上面的示例代碼中,假設當前工作目錄中有一個名為"data"的文件夾,并且該文件夾下有一個名為"file.txt"的文件。相對路徑"data/file.txt"會被解析成當前工作目錄加上相對路徑,從而得到要讀取的文件的完整路徑。如果文件存在,則逐行讀取文件內容并打印出來;如果文件不存在,則輸出"文件不存在"。

  這種方法可以適用于大多數Java項目的文件讀取需求。但需要注意的是,相對路徑是相對于工作目錄或指定基準目錄的,所以在不同環境或不同操作系統下運行時,工作目錄可能會有所不同,需要根據具體情況進行相應的路徑處理和管理。

其他答案

  •   在Java中,我們可以使用相對路徑來讀取文件。相對路徑是相對于當前工作目錄或指定的基準目錄進行解析的路徑。下面是一般的相對路徑文件讀取操作步驟:

      確定當前工作目錄:使用System.getProperty("user.dir")方法獲取當前Java程序所在的工作目錄路徑。這個路徑是相對于操作系統的。

      構建文件路徑:使用相對路徑來構建文件的完整路徑。相對路徑是相對于當前工作目錄的路徑??梢允褂肑ava的File類的構造函數來構建文件對象,傳入完整路徑的字符串參數。

      檢查文件是否存在:使用File類的exists()方法來檢查文件是否存在。如果文件存在,可以進行后續的文件讀取操作;如果文件不存在,則根據需要進行相應的異常處理或錯誤提示。

      文件讀?。菏褂煤线m的文件讀取方式(如FileInputStream、BufferedReader等)來讀取文件的內容。

      下面是一個示例代碼,展示了如何使用相對路徑讀取文件:

      import java.io.BufferedReader;

      import java.io.File;

      import java.io.FileNotFoundException;

      import java.io.FileReader;

      import java.io.IOException;

      public class RelativePathExample {

      public static void main(String[] args) {

      // 獲取當前工作目錄

      String currentDir = System.getProperty("user.dir");

      // 構建文件路徑

      String relativePath = "data/file.txt";

      String filePath = currentDir + File.separator + relativePath;

      // 創建文件對象

      File file = new File(filePath);

      // 檢查文件是否存在

      if (file.exists()) {

      try {

      // 讀取文件內容

      BufferedReader reader = new BufferedReader(new FileReader(file));

      String line;

      while ((line = reader.readLine()) != null) {

      System.out.println(line);

      }

      reader.close();

      } catch (IOException e) {

      e.printStackTrace();

      }

      } else {

      System.out.println("文件不存在");

      }

      }

      }

      在上述示例代碼中,假設當前工作目錄中有一個名為"data"的文件夾,其中包含一個名為"file.txt"的文件。使用相對路徑"data/file.txt"構建文件的完整路徑,并創建File對象。然后,檢查文件是否存在,如果存在則讀取文件內容并逐行打印,否則輸出提示信息。

      需要注意的是,相對路徑是相對于工作目錄的,因此在不同環境或操作系統中,工作目錄可能有所不同。因此,需要針對具體情況進行路徑處理和管理。

  •   Java中可以使用相對路徑讀取文件。相對路徑是相對于當前工作目錄或指定的基準目錄進行解析的路徑。下面是一般的相對路徑讀取文件的步驟:

      確定當前工作目錄:使用System.getProperty("user.dir")方法獲取當前Java程序所在的工作目錄路徑。這個路徑是相對于操作系統的。

      構建文件路徑:使用相對路徑來構建文件的完整路徑。相對路徑是相對于當前工作目錄的路徑。通常使用Java的File類的構造函數來構建文件對象,傳入完整路徑的字符串參數。

      檢查文件是否存在:使用File類的exists()方法來檢查文件是否存在。如果文件存在,可以進行后續的文件讀取操作;如果文件不存在,則根據需要進行相應的異常處理或錯誤提示。

      文件讀?。菏褂眠m當的文件讀取方式(如FileInputStream、BufferedReader等)來讀取文件的內容。

      下面是一個示例代碼,展示了如何使用相對路徑讀取文件:

      javaimport java.io.BufferedReader;

      import java.io.File;

      import java.io.FileReader;

      import java.io.IOException;

      public class RelativePathExample {

      public static void main(String[] args) {

      // 獲取當前工作目錄

      String currentDir = System.getProperty("user.dir");

      // 構建文件路徑

      String relativePath = "data/file.txt";

      String filePath = currentDir + File.separator + relativePath;

      // 創建文件對象

      File file = new File(filePath);

      // 檢查文件是否存在

      if (file.exists()) {

      try {

      // 讀取文件內容

      BufferedReader reader = new BufferedReader(new FileReader(file));

      String line;

      while ((line = reader.readLine()) != null) {

      System.out.println(line);

      }

      reader.close();

      } catch (IOException e) {

      e.printStackTrace();

      }

      } else {

      System.out.println("文件不存在");

      }

      }

      }

      在上述示例代碼中,假設當前工作目錄中有一個名為"data"的文件夾,其中包含一個名為"file.txt"的文件。使用相對路徑"data/file.txt"構建文件的完整路徑,并創建File對象。然后,檢查文件是否存在,如果存在則讀取文件內容并逐行打印,否則輸出提示信息。

      需要注意的是,相對路徑是相對于工作目錄的,因此在不同的環境或操作系統中,工作目錄可能有所不同。因此,需要根據具體情況進行路徑處理和管理。

一本久久精品一区二区| 亚洲欧美国产精品久久| 亚洲男人第一无码AV网站| 在线观看特色大片免费网站 | 国语精品自产拍在线观看网站| 精品少妇AY一区二区三区| 免费国精产品一品二品| 日韩精品人妻系列无码专区| 亚州熟妇无码AV线播放| 尤物爆乳AV导航| 吃瓜网51CG7爆料| 国产制服丝袜在线无码| 蜜桃无码一区二区三区| 色婷婷狠狠18禁久久YYY| 亚洲国产AV无码一区二区三区 | 国产成人精品视频网站| 精品无码日韩国产不卡AV| 欧美激情精品久久久久久黑人| 天堂А√在线中文在线| 亚洲无AV码一区二区三区| 把腿扒开做爽爽视频| 国产亚洲精品精品国产亚洲综合| 老女人性饥渴XXXXⅩHD另| 搡老熟女老女人HHD| 亚洲欧美日韩、中文字幕不卡| H无码动漫在线观看人| 国精产品一二三四区产品| 年级老师的滋味4| 无码天堂亚洲国产AV| 又色又爽又黄的裸体美女图片| 大白屁股白浆XXⅩSS| 久久99精品久久久久久青青| 日产精品久久久一区二区| 亚洲清清爽爽AABB| 方辰苏婉儿是哪本小说的主角| 久久国产热这里只有精品| 肉妇春潮干柴烈火MYFDUCC| 亚洲在AV人极品无码网站| 儿子比老公更大更硬朗| 久久人人爽人人爽人人片AV高清 | 久久久受WWW免费人成| 少妇粉嫩小泬喷水视频WWW| 伊人久久大香线蕉AV波多野结衣 | BGMBGMBGM成熟交| 狠狠色成人一区二区三区| 人人妻人人澡人人爽人人精品97| 亚洲国产精品久久久久久久 | 日韩欧美亚洲国产精品字幕久久久| 亚洲精品无码久久一线| 草草永久地址发布页①| 久久久久免费精品国产| 乌克兰少妇XXXX做受| A一区二区三区乱码在线 | 欧| 黑人与中国娇小美女AV在线 | 初尝黑人嗷嗷叫中文字幕| 久久久国产精品消防器材| 天堂…中文在线最新版在线| 综合无码精品人妻一区二区三区| 国产午夜精品一区二区三区极品 | 波多野结衣HD在线观看| 久久麻豆精亚洲AV品国产APP| 挺进大幂幂的滋润花苞御女天下| 97精品伊人久久大香线蕉| 精品久久久久久狼人社区| 特级毛片内射WWW无码| av在线一区二区三区| 久久精品国产精油按摩| 五十路レンタのおばさん| 被青梅竹马的学弟给锁定了林擎霄| 久久久受WWW免费人成| 亚洲AⅤ永久无码一区二区三区| 被C了一节课的林妙妙| 美女把尿口扒开让男人桶| 亚洲第一无码AV播放器| 国产成人无码18禁午夜福利P| 欧美日韩视频一区二区| 一本一道精品欧美中文字幕| 国产强被迫伦姧在线观看无码| 日本JAPANESE护士人妻| 自偷自拍亚洲综合精品麻豆| 精品国产AⅤ无码一区二区蜜桃| 天天澡天天添天天摸97影院| 白嫩美女被内射59| 男生女生一起相差差差30| 亚洲自偷图片自拍图片| 好硬好湿好爽再深一点动态图片| 天天躁日日躁狠狠躁退| 成人欧美一区二区三区在线| 欧美黑人XXXX性高清版| 中国女人熟毛茸茸A毛片| 久久精品99国产精品蜜桃| 亚洲AV无码一区二区三区乱码4| 国产成人无码免费视频在线| 日韩精品一二三区| 啊灬啊灬啊灬快灬深高潮了亚洲乱色视频在线观看 | 武则天裸毛片70分钟| 丰满少妇被猛烈进入高清播放| 欧美人与动牲交免费观看视频| 在线观看成人无码中文AV天堂| 精品国产一二三产品区别在哪 | 国产国语对白又大又粗又爽| 日韩AV无码一区二区三区不卡| 99久E在线精品视频在线| 麻花豆传媒剧国产MV的特点| 艳妇乳肉豪妇荡乳在线观看| 精品久久久久久国产牛牛| 亚洲AV永久无码成人私密按摩 | 国产AV旡码专区亚洲AV苍井空| 人妖CHINESECDTS在线| 锕锕锕锕锕锕~好深啊APP下载 | A级毛片高清免费播放| 欧美 国产 综合 欧美 视频| 最新永久无码AV网址亚洲| 每天都在挨CAO中醒来H| 中文精品久久久久人妻不卡| 久久无码精品一区二区三区| 一本久久A精品一区二区| 久久久久久一区国产精品| 亚洲中字幕日产2021草莓| 久久婷婷五月综合色精品| 野花社区韩国视频WWW了| 久久无码中文字幕免费影院蜜桃 | 欧美黑人猛XXxXX内射| 51FUN吃瓜网-热心群众| 男女作爱免费网站在线观看| 中文字幕日产乱码国内自 | 99热成人精品热久久6网站| 欧美成人AⅤ高清免费观看| CEK俄罗斯BNAE0| 日本50岁丰满熟妇XXXX| 大肉大捧一进一出的视频| 天堂√最新版中文在线天堂| 国产精品久久久久久无遮挡| 性亚洲VIDEOFREE高清极| 精品v内射66偷窥| 亚洲最大综合久久网成人| 迷迷糊糊挺进岳身体| FREEZEFRAME丰满少妇| 人妻无码熟妇乱又视频| 丰满少妇人妻HD高清果冻传媒| 十八女人毛片A级毛片水真多| 国产精品秘 入口A级熟女| 亚洲AV无码国产精品久久| 精品乱码一区二区三区四区| 一边下奶一边吃面膜视频| 男人天堂2018| 成人H视频在线观看| 天天想你视频免费观看西瓜| 国产亚洲精品A在线无码| 亚洲欧美在线综合色影视| 老熟妇高潮一区二区三区网| 99RIAV国产精品视频| 日本熟妇厨房XXXXX乱| 国产精品久久久久久无毒不卡| 亚洲丰满性熟妇ⅩXXOOO太阳| 久久人妻少妇偷人精品综合桃色 | 伊人精品无码一区二区三区电影| 欧美XXX性喷潮| 丰满熟妇人妻AV无码区| 亚洲AV无码成人黄网站在线观看| 精品亚洲国产成人AV| 中文字幕日韩一区二区三区不卡 | 亚洲色成人WWW永久在线观看| 麻豆亚洲AV永久无码精品久久| 啊灬啊灬啊灬快灬高潮了女| 玩弄人妻少妇500系列视频| 精品久久综合1区2区3区激情| 做I爱直播APP| 熟女一区二区蜜桃视频| 精JAVAPARSER乱偷| 69无人区乱码一二三四区别| 日韩揉捏奶头高潮不断视频| 国产午夜手机精彩视频| 在厨房娇妻被朋友胯下挺进| 日本黄色网址日本| 国产熟妇人妻ⅩXXXX麻豆网址| 伊人久久大香线蕉AV网| 日韩精品无码一区二区| 狠色狠色狠狠色综合久久| 69美女黑人做受XXXXXⅩ| 天天做天天爱夭大综合网| 久久久精品国产免大香伊| 被男人吃奶很爽的毛片| 亚洲AV无码AV在线播放| 免费观看的国产大片APP下载| 丰满爆乳一区二区三区| 亚洲色成人网站www观看入口| 人妻 日韩 欧美 综合 制服| 国内美女推油按摩在线播放| 中文字幕乱码亚洲∧V日本| 天美传媒MV免费观看软件特色| 久久久久久国产精品免费无码| 扒开双腿疯狂进出爽爽爽动态图| 亚洲AV无码成人精品区在线播放 | 成人国产一区二区三区| 亚洲旡码A∨一区二区三区| 全部AV―极品视觉盛宴| 狠狠躁夜夜躁AV网站色| 暗呦交小U女国产精品视频| 亚洲成A人V在线蜜臀|